 <title>U-verse TV aims for 1 million subs this year</title>
 <link>http://www.fierceiptv.com/story/u-verse-tv-aims-1-million-subs-year/2008-07-24?utm_medium=rss&amp;utm_source=rss&amp;cmp-id=OTC-RSS-FI0</link>
 <description>&lt;p&gt;If AT&amp;amp;T has anything to do with it, Verizon Communications soon will not be the only U.S. telco TV player with more than&amp;nbsp;1 million customers. AT&amp;amp;T said in its second quarter earnings report yeseterday that it added&amp;nbsp;170,000 U-verse TV subscribers during the quarter, and that it still expects to surpass 1 million customers for the IPTV offering by the end of this year. The telco giant ended the second quarter with about 549,000 subscribers.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;The company&#039;s U-verse&amp;nbsp;service is available to 11 million households in about 53 markets. AT&amp;amp;T officials said the TV service has achieved 10 percent penetration in a handful of markets, and they also made the case that access line loss is not as severe in those markets as it is in other. Still, AT&amp;amp;T&#039;s landlines are down about 8 percent since the second quarter of 2007.&lt;/p&gt;

 <title>Cablevision adds video subs, strikes Newsday deal</title>
 <link>http://www.fierceiptv.com/story/cablevision-adds-video-subs-strikes-newsday-deal/2008-05-13?utm_medium=rss&amp;utm_source=rss&amp;cmp-id=OTC-RSS-FI0</link>
 <description>
&lt;P&gt;While some cable TV companies are taking an obvious hit from telco IPTV competition (see Comcast), others may not be seeing much of an impact. Cablevision Systems last week said it added 41,000 digital-video subscribers and 2,000 basic-video customers to its current 3.1 million video subscribers during the first quarter of this year, adding that it has seen little impact from Verizon Communications&#039; FiOS service. The company also has moved aggressively into Verizon&#039;s traditional segments with its Optimum Lightpath data and voice services. In addition, the company said it will spend more than $300 million on rolling out Wi-Fi technology in the New York metro area and on Long Island over the next two years. &lt;/p&gt;
&lt;P&gt;This week, Cablevision made another intriguing, though somewhat puzzling move, saying it will pay $650 million to acquire most of suburban newspaper&amp;nbsp;&lt;EM&gt;Newsday&lt;/em&gt;. Arguably, &lt;EM&gt;Newsday&lt;/em&gt; could help Cablevision competitively by giving it more promotional heft for its offerings against whatever marketing blitz competitor Verizon may muster. It could also create cross-selling opportunities for advertisers that might be thinking of moving more money over to IPTV platforms. Still, newspapers as medium are weakening by the hour, so the benefits could be short-term at best.&lt;/p&gt;

 <title>Dish Network can&#039;t match DirecTV growth</title>
 <link>http://www.fierceiptv.com/story/dish-network-can-t-match-directv-growth/2008-05-13?utm_medium=rss&amp;utm_source=rss&amp;cmp-id=OTC-RSS-FI0</link>
 <description>
&lt;P&gt;It is still too early to tell how AT&amp;amp;T&#039;s new commitment to re-sell Dish Network satellite TV services across all of its markets will affect Dish&#039;s business, but as the sales effort gears up, it will come none too soon. Dish Network reported as part of its first quarter financial results this week that it added only 35,000 new subscribers during the quarter, almost 89 percent less than the 310,000 it added for the same quarter last year. The figure also is far less than DirecTV&#039;s Q1 subscriber additions of about 275,000, posted last week.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;P&gt;AT&amp;amp;T had been re-selling both Dish Network and DirecTV service, the latter in the former BellSouth region, but recently committed to go forward with Dish alone. Did it bet on the wrong horse, and by the way, how much is AT&amp;amp;T&#039;s own IPTV success affecting its satellite TV partner?&lt;/p&gt;

 <title>Comcast takes video hit, but adds telephony subs</title>
 <link>http://www.fierceiptv.com/story/comcast-takes-video-hit-but-adds-telephony-subs/2008-05-06?utm_medium=rss&amp;utm_source=rss&amp;cmp-id=OTC-RSS-FI0</link>
 <description>
&lt;P&gt;Is video becoming a point of market weakness for cable TV companies? That could be the case if we decide to invest in the trend suggested by Comcast&#039;s first quarter 2008 earnings report last week. The company said that it lost 57,000 basic video subscribers during the quarter, and even though it added about 494,000 digital video customers, the latter number was observed to be less than some analyst estimates, according to &lt;I&gt;The Wall Street Journal&lt;/i&gt;. Comcast also saw its first-quarter profit dip about 12.5 percent compared to the same period last year. Still, it remains to be seen if video softness is an industry-wide trend. Time Warner Cable had said previously that it added both basic video and digital video customers during the quarter, and at least met estimates in both areas.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;P&gt;Meanwhile, Comcast added 639,000 digital telephony subscribers during the first quarter and almost half a million broadband Internet customers. Comcast now has about 5.1 million voice customers, and seems to be one of the chief beneficiaries of telco landline loss, but its ability to steal voice customers from telcos is not impressive enough to cover the higher-value video customers it is losing to the telcos. &lt;/p&gt;

 <title>KPN adds 56,000 IPTV customers in Q1</title>
 <link>http://www.fierceiptv.com/story/kpn-adds-56000-iptv-customers-in-q1/2008-05-06?utm_medium=rss&amp;utm_source=rss&amp;cmp-id=OTC-RSS-FI0</link>
 <description>
&lt;P&gt;Dutch telco KPN Telecom reported that it signed up 56,000 new IPTV customers during its first quarter, a boost that now gives the company about 553,000 IPTV subscribers. The main IPTV competition in the Netherlands for KPN is Tele2. The additional IPTV helped fuel a 22% rise in KPN&#039;s overall revenue for the quarter. The company has been rumored in the past to be a potential acquisition target for firms such as AT&amp;amp;T and Spain&#039;s Telefonica, but KPN official said the telco currently is not engaged in any takeover talks.&lt;/p&gt;

 <title>Verizon posts 263K TV customer boost</title>
 <link>http://www.fierceiptv.com/story/verizon-posts-263k-tv-customer-boost/2008-04-29?utm_medium=rss&amp;utm_source=rss&amp;cmp-id=OTC-RSS-FI0</link>
 <description>
&lt;P&gt;Verizon Communications this week reported a 9.8% increase in profit for the first quarter of 2008. Verizon said net income totaled $1.64 billion, with revenue rising about 5.5%. Much of the growth came from Verizon Wireless, but Verizon FiOS TV service continue to be secondary source of strength. The telco reported that FiOS TV subscribers increased by 263,000 FiOS TV customers during the quarter, giving a total of about 1.2 million TV customers.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;P&gt;AT&amp;amp;T last week reported it had gained about 148,000 U-verse TV customers, so the two largest telcos won over more than 400,000 TV customers in the first three months of this year. That can&#039;t be good news for a cable TV industry that has been knocked around competitively by AT&amp;amp;T and Verizon since last year.&lt;/p&gt;

 <title>AT&amp;T adds 148,000 U-verse TV customers</title>
 <link>http://www.fierceiptv.com/story/att-adds-148000-u-verse-tv-customers/2008-04-22?utm_medium=rss&amp;utm_source=rss&amp;cmp-id=OTC-RSS-FI0</link>
 <description>
&lt;P&gt;AT&amp;amp;T said in its first-quarter earnings report today that it gained about 148,000 U-verse TV subscribers during the quarter, bringing its total IPTV service tally to about 379,000. Though Verizon Communications continues to set the high mark for U.S. telcos, with more than 1 million FiOS TV customers, AT&amp;amp;T is posting strong growth quarter by quarter as it puts some early growing pains in the past. The telco said it is on track to obtain 1 million U-verse TV customers by the end of this year. If you add satellite TV customers into the mix, AT&amp;amp;T now serves about 2.6 million TV customers total.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;P&gt;Yet, success in this new business arena and in wireless are not allowing AT&amp;amp;T to skate through the otherwise unstable landline telecom sector. The company last week said it would lay off more than 4,600 employees, though it still intends to keep hiring for jobs specific to growth areas such as TV and wireless. Many industry watchers are predicting other telcos will make similar cuts this year as they try to focus on what will be the core telco businesses of the future.&lt;/p&gt;

 <title>Mobile TV still not fulfilling its potential</title>
 <link>http://www.fierceiptv.com/story/mobile-tv-still-not-fulfilling-its-potential/2008-04-22?utm_medium=rss&amp;utm_source=rss&amp;cmp-id=OTC-RSS-FI0</link>
 <description>
&lt;P&gt;Mobile TV continues to be a source of excitement for the mobile industry, but the recent Mobile TV World Summit in London was a venue at which some firms involved in the mobile TV ecosystem vented their concerns about the success of the service thus far, according to &lt;EM&gt;Digital Broadcast&lt;/em&gt;. &lt;/p&gt;
&lt;P&gt;This is not an IPTV issue, strictly speaking, but since mobile TV is one aspect of any major telco&#039;s push into the TV realm, it may offer some valuable lessons. One of those lessons, according to some of the London event, is that service providers need to simplify packaging and pricing of mobile TV. At least one speaker urged service providers to include mobile TV in flat-rate service plans, rather than charging an additional fee of up to $15 for the service (If you are a Verizon Wireless customer, you recognize that price tag).&lt;/p&gt;
